everyone has their own goals.

For me, I needed a bed top that could not block the bed when I want to haul. I got the RollNLock bed cover.
I needed to use the bed for cargo straight away and didn't want scratches and ultimatly premature wear on the bed vs the cab. I got spray in liner.
As it happens, my kids had problems loading/unloading. I got some step up bars.

My coworkers with the same generation opted for the pedal commander for a more fun pedal response. I know I would demolish my fuel efficiency even more with stronger pedal response.

My brother swears by his weathertech cab mats.

unless you plan on some serious towing, I would caution against the tow package. you lose a few creture comforts like the 360 cam, power folding mirrors and dynamic ride height air suspension.

x2 on not getting the tow package. The 3.92's will pull most anything you want and unless the trailer is one of those 102" wide ones, the regular mirrors with extenders works fine. I don't tow so I accepted a 3.21. Many members do tow ,8,000 and also use 3.21.
I'd say get the ETorque and 3.92's for resale, but that's totally your decision.
Is the multi-function tailgate worth almost a grand to you? Sounds like a nice option however its spendy.

OK, so I didn't get the E-Torque (truck IS ordered, BTW) because of the Auto Stop/Start. If I were confident it could be turned off in tuning I would have gone for it. I will be doing an exhaust - probably either a Mufflex/Magnaflow or Borla cat-back - and the stop/start from perfectly silent to full roar would be very disconcerting to me...

The milti-function tailgate was attractive to me, but it's only available with the E-Torque!

Very strange set of rules they have as to what you can and can't get together. In addition to the tailgate thing, you can't get the surround view camera unless you get the Level 2 Equip Pkg. And you can't get the Level 2 unless you get the E-Torque!!
